Disability shower installation services focus on creating accessible bathing solutions tailored to individuals with mobility challenges or physical limitations. These services typically involve replacing existing showers with designs that prioritize safety, ease of use, and independence. Features may include low or no-threshold entryways, grab bars, non-slip flooring, and adjustable or handheld showerheads. The goal is to provide a functional and comfortable bathing environment that accommodates specific needs, making daily routines safer and more manageable.
These installations address common problems such as difficulty entering traditional showers, risk of slips and falls, and limited maneuverability within standard bathroom setups. For seniors, individuals recovering from injury, or those with disabilities, traditional showers can pose significant safety hazards. Disability shower installation services help mitigate these risks by transforming bathrooms into safer spaces. They also assist in reducing the need for assistance during bathing, promoting autonomy and dignity for users.

Installation Costs - The typical cost for installing a disability shower ranges from $1,500 to $4,000, depending on the complexity and features selected. Basic models may be closer to the lower end, while custom designs can approach the higher end.
Materials and Features - Costs vary based on the shower materials and accessibility features, with standard installations averaging around $2,000 to $5,000. Upgraded fixtures, non-slip surfaces, and additional safety elements can increase expenses.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for disability shower installation generally fall between $500 and $1,500. The total depends on the existing plumbing setup and any necessary modifications to the bathroom space.
Additional Costs - Additional expenses may include permit fees, which can range from $100 to $500, and potential plumbing or electrical upgrades. Contact local pros for detailed estimates tailored to spec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
